The castle Kirnberg is an Outbound hilltop castle on the 585 m above sea level. NHN Kirnberg massif 1500 meters south of the church in the Orsingen district of the Orsingen-Nenzingen community in the district of Konstanz in Baden-Württemberg in Germany .
Small remains of ramparts and moats have been preserved from the former castle .
